About Kalipso Chalkidou
Kalipso Chalkidou is a scholar working on Economics and Econometrics, Finance and General Health Professions, having authored 115 papers that have together received 5.5k ind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Health Systems, Economic Evaluations, Quality of Life (81 papers), Healthcare cost, quality, practices (28 papers), Healthcare Policy and Management (28 papers), Healthcare Systems and Reforms (25 papers), Global Health Care Issues (21 papers), Pharmaceutical Economics and Policy (19 papers), Global Maternal and Child Health (15 papers) and Global Public Health Policies and Epidemiology (14 papers). The work is most often cited by research in General Health Professions (2.0k citations), Economics and Econometrics (2.2k citations) and Organizational Behavior and Human Resource Management (575 citations). Kalipso Chalkidou has collaborated with scholars based in United Kingdom, United States and Thailand. Frequent co-authors include Sean Tunis, Merrick Zwarenstein, Shaun Treweek, Eduardo Bergel, Kevin E. Thorpe, David J. Magid, Curt D. Furberg, Douglas G. Altman, Ian Harvey and Andrew D Oxman. Their work appears in journals such as New England Journal of Medicine, The Lancet and Journal of Clinical Oncology.
